WALA/BOA Trademark Basics
January 26, 2022 •
Event Summary
Are you interested in learning more about trademarks?
What exactly are trademarks?
What is their function?
How can you use your trademark?
What’s the difference between a registered and unregistered trademark?
What is a service mark?
Can you register a sound, smell, color?
Come to this session and bring your questions!
Presentation and Q & A session with: Robyn Mohr
Robyn Mohr, an attorney with Loeb & Loeb, counsels clients on a wide variety of matters related to new media, technology, mobile and digital marketing, advertising, and privacy. She also advises on compliance with various state and federal laws and regulations, representing clients in a variety of industries, including consumer products, telecommunications, internet and entertainment.
